1. Experience and Expertise:
One of the most critical aspects to consider when looking for epoxy garage floor installers is their experience and expertise in the field. Look for installers who have been in the industry for a substantial period. Experienced installers are more likely to have honed their skills, developed efficient installation techniques, and have a better understanding of potential challenges that may arise during the process. They can also provide valuable advice and recommendations based on their extensive knowledge.
2. Reputation and Reviews:
Before hiring any epoxy garage floor installer, take the time to research their reputation and read customer reviews. A reputable installer will have a track record of satisfied customers and positive feedback. Look for testimonials on their website, social media platforms, or review websites. Additionally, ask for references and contact previous clients to inquire about their experience with the installer. This due diligence will help you gauge the installer's professionalism, workmanship, and customer service.
3. Portfolio and Samples:

A reliable epoxy garage floor installer should have a portfolio of completed projects and samples of their work. By reviewing their portfolio, you can assess the quality of their installations and get an idea of their style and attention to detail. Pay attention to the level of smoothness, shine, and uniformity of the coatings. Ask for samples of different epoxy finishes and colors to ensure they can meet your specific preferences.
4. Licensing and Insurance:
Ensure that the epoxy garage floor installers you consider are properly licensed and insured. Licensing indicates that they have met the necessary requirements and adhere to industry standards. Insurance coverage protects you and your property in case of any accidents or damages that may occur during the installation process. Request proof of insurance and verify its validity before proceeding with any agreement.
5. Warranty and After-Sales Support:
Reliable epoxy garage floor installers stand behind their workmanship and offer warranties on their installations. A warranty gives you peace of mind, knowing that the installer will address any issues or defects that may arise within a specified period. Inquire about the warranty terms, including the duration, coverage, and any limitations. Additionally, ask about their after-sales support and whether they provide maintenance instructions or services to ensure the longevity of your epoxy floor.
6. Clear Communication and Transparency:
Good communication is vital when working with any contractor. Reliable epoxy garage floor installers should be responsive to your inquiries, listen to your requirements, and provide clear explanations of the installation process. They should also be transparent about pricing, materials, and any potential limitations or challenges that may arise. A professional installer will provide a written estimate and contract that outlines all the details, ensuring both parties are on the same page.
